Alta Vista Snowshoe is a 1-mile roundtrip trail located at Paradise. It’s considered an easy snowshoe trail and typically takes about 90 minutes to snowshoe.

Alta Vista Snowshoe is a 1-mile roundtrip trail located at Paradise. It’s considered an easy snowshoe trail and typically takes about 90 minutes to snowshoe.
Stay up to date
"*" indicates required fields